## Changed defaults: cron jobs moved to Driftloom

As of this release, all scheduled jobs formerly run by the legacy cron host now execute on the Driftloom workflow engine. Defaults changed: retries are 3 with exponential backoff (was 0), jobs are idempotency-keyed, overlapping runs are skipped rather than queued, and timezone handling is UTC-only. New team members: do not add crontab entries; register workflows instead. Old cron host is read-only until end of quarter. The engine ships with the defaults below.

settings of tagef-bawif:
DRUIX_HOST=druix.zemvarlabs.internal
DRUIX_PORT=8000

## Handover: EXIF scrubbing pipeline

For the weekly sync — handing the Brambleway EXIF scrubber from me (Orin) to Della. State of play: the scrubber strips GPS and serial-number tags on upload, runs as a sidecar to the media ingest worker, and quarantines files it can't parse rather than passing them through. Known gap: HEIC files with nested metadata blocks sometimes skip scrubbing; fix is half-done on the feature branch. The service currently runs with the configuration shown below.

config for haweg-bagag:
[kasath]
host = kasath.qirvancorp.internal
user = kasath_svc
database = kasath_prod

AUDIT ITEM 14: Legacy ORM refactor — Tallowgrid

Verify the old Hobnail ORM layer is fully removed from billing paths. Check: no raw mapper calls remain, repository pattern adopted in all three modules, integration tests pass against the Cindervault schema, and the deprecated session pool is deleted. New team members should flag any Hobnail import they find. Findings and exceptions must be reported to the owner named below.

approver of tawif-kafog = Lamdor Brivan